Introduction

Marketing automation is more than just a buzzword; it's a strategic approach that leverages technology to automate repetitive tasks and workflows, allowing marketers to focus on more creative and high-impact activities. Marketing automation is about delivering the right message to the right audience at the right time.



Critical Concepts of Marketing Automation

Overview of Marketing Automation

Marketing automation encompasses many tools and processes to streamline and automate marketing activities. From customer relationship management (CRM) to email marketing automation, social media scheduling, and analytics, marketing automation platforms integrate various functionalities to create a unified marketing ecosystem.

Core Components

Understanding the core components is crucial for harnessing the full potential of marketing automation. CRM serves as the foundation for managing customer data and interactions. Email marketing automation facilitates personalized and targeted communication. Social media automation ensures consistent and timely posts, while analytics and reporting provide insights for data-driven decision-making.



Benefits of Marketing Automation

The benefits of marketing automation are multifaceted. Among the key advantages are increased efficiency, improved targeting and personalization, enhanced lead nurturing, and data-driven decision-making. By automating repetitive tasks, marketers can allocate more time to strategy development and creative endeavours, ultimately driving better results.



Getting Started with Marketing Automation

Assessing Business Goals and Objectives

Before diving into the world of marketing automation, it's crucial to define your business goals and marketing objectives. Whether you aim to increase lead generation, improve customer retention, or boost sales, aligning automation efforts with these goals sets the stage for success.

Building a Target Audience Profile

Creating a target audience profile involves defining buyer personas and segmenting your audience based on demographics, behaviour, and preferences. This step ensures that your automated campaigns are tailored to different customer segments' specific needs and interests.

Selecting the Right Marketing Automation Tool

Choosing the right marketing automation tool is a pivotal decision. Evaluate tools based on features, scalability, and integration options. Consider your current needs and future growth to select a platform that aligns with your business requirements.



Implementing Marketing Automation

Setting Up the System

Integrating CRM and marketing automation lays the groundwork for a seamless workflow. Configure email campaigns that resonate with your audience and align with your business objectives. Customization is key, ensuring that your automated processes reflect your brand's unique personality.

Creating Automated Workflows

Automated workflows are the backbone of marketing automation. Establish lead scoring mechanisms to identify and prioritize prospects. Develop drip campaigns and nurture sequences that guide leads through the sales funnel, providing valuable content at each stage.

Designing Personalized Content

Content is king, even in the realm of marketing automation. Tailor your messages to suit different buyer personas and leverage dynamic content to ensure your communications remain relevant and engaging. Personalization fosters a stronger connection with your audience.



Measuring and Analyzing Performance

Establishing Key Performance Indicators (KPIs)

Setting clear key performance indicators (KPIs) is essential for measuring the success of your marketing automation efforts. Whether it's conversion rates, engagement metrics, or other performance indicators, KPIs provide a benchmark for evaluating the effectiveness of your campaigns.

Monitoring and Reporting

Utilize analytics tools to monitor the performance of your automated campaigns continually. Regularly review and update your strategies based on the insights gained from these tools. The iterative nature of marketing automation allows for continuous improvement and optimization.



Common Challenges and Best Practices

Overcoming Implementation Challenges

Implementing marketing automation may pose challenges, including resistance to change and data quality and integration issues. Addressing these challenges head-on by providing adequate training and investing in data management solutions is crucial for a smooth transition.

Best Practices for Successful Marketing Automation

Regularly reviewing and updating workflows, conducting A/B testing, and optimizing campaigns based on performance are key best practices. Marketing automation is not a one-time implementation but an ongoing process that requires adaptability and a commitment to improvement.



Future Trends in Marketing Automation

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ning

The future of marketing automation lies in integrating art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ML). These technologies enhance personalization, predictive analytics, and automation, allowing businesses to stay ahead in the rapidly evolving digital landscape.

Integration with Emerging Technologies

As technology continues to advance, marketing automation will likely integrate with emerging technologies such as augmented reality (AR), virtual reality (VR), and the Internet of Things (IoT). These integrations open up new possibilities for immersive and highly personalized marketing experiences.

Evolving Customer Expectations

Customer expectations are continually evolving. Successful marketing automation strategies must adapt to changing consumer preferences and privacy concerns. Staying attuned to these shifts ensures your automated campaigns remain relevant and practical.
